Court says sleeper berth time over 8 hours is compensable

Commercial Carrier Journal

The First Circuit Court of Appeals affirmed a previous ruling that, under the Fair Labor Standards Act, team drivers should be paid for time spent in the sleeper berth beyond 8 hours because time spent there is to the benefit of the employer.

EROAD’s Guide to Running a Sustainable Trucking Business

Over the last three decades, emissions from new trucks have been reduced by more than 98 percent. In fact, it would take 60 of today’s trucks to generate the same level of emissions from a single truck in 1988. Despite these impressive improvements, many trucking businesses continue to seek methods to achieve sustainability goals in a viable, measurable way.

Project Logistics: The Basics You Should Know

MTS Logistics

Project logistics takes place successfully all over the world everyday thanks to a mix of experienced personnel, intense coordination, planning, and savvy use of logistics technology. Project logistics is a very complex field and covers many great aspects. Simply put, Project logistics is the transportation processes of cargo with characteristics such as large, heavy, bulky, out-of-gauge, unusually shaped, high-value and critical items.

Maersk Pauses Shipments in Red Sea Again Following More Attacks

MTS Logistics

Just a few days ago, we previously reported on Operation Prosperity Guardian, which the U.S. and its allies launched in an effort to clamp down and stop attacks in the Red Sea and other critical Middle Eastern waterways. What changed since last week? Since last Friday, there was another major attack over the weekend. That attack has caused shipping giant Maersk to reverse its decision to resume shipping operations in the Red Sea.

CARB Extends Clean Truck Check Reporting Deadline

NGT News

The California Air Resources Board (CARB) has extended the reporting deadline for Clean Truck Check, giving heavy-duty truck owners and operators extra time to enter their information into a new database that will track compliance. Vehicle/fleet owners now have until January 31, 2024, to complete the initial reporting requirement and compliance fee payment for 2023.
